Output c39836a6bafca44e0e360a68251011e8da25cd6c5724f61cda170c29057d4eb9: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c42c8de193210b7ba96ceb3e2cbd3639da8453 OP_EQUAL
address
3BLFt6bEUwe4A49rkGkaG4XEeDpztMuYgc
transaction
c39836a6bafca44e0e360a68251011e8da25cd6c5724f61cda170c29057d4eb9
confirmations
513634
spent
true